Limelight

Limelight

When rare Living Shards are combined with Radioactive Sludge and a dash of Curds and Whey, they form this cheese, which boasts a mineral flavor with a hint of lime. The shards vibrate within the curd, making high-pitched noises difficult for the human ear to hear. This subtle vibration sends tremors through the ground, which attract the mice living under the soil in Digby.

Overview

Limelight Cheese is a special cheese required to attract a group of underground physical mice that can only be found in the Town of Digby.

Our standard price for Limelight Cheese is 1,320 gold per piece.

Crafting Recipes

Limelight Cheese can be crafted in the following ways:

3 Limelight Cheese


30 Curds and
Whey

3 Living
Shard

3 Radioactive
Sludge
6 Limelight Cheese


30 Curds and
Whey

3 Living
Shard

6 Magic
Essence

3 Radioactive
Sludge

Special Items

Limelight Cheese can be found in the following special items:

Poking an Unstable Curd may result in 10 Limelight Cheese.

Special Properties

Limelight Cheese is the only known cheese to reliably attract the following mice:


Big Bad Burroughs

Core Sample

Demolitions

Industrious Digger

Itty-Bitty Burroughs

Lambent Crystal

Miner

Nugget

Rock Muncher

Stone Cutter

Subterranean
